INTERNET USAGE PATTERNS AMONG MALES AND FEMALES STUDENTS AT COLLEGES OF BHIWANI CITY: A SURVEY

Abstract

The Internet is rapidly becoming part of everyday life and empowering people in all part of the globe. There is no reliable data on the patterns of usage of Internet among males and females in a small city of third world country. A survey of usage of Internet was undertaken with a convenience sampling method of data collection from the field. The sample of the present investigation was students of various colleges in the Bhiwani city, because students are regarded as trends setter. The data of the survey based on 477 respondents were analyzed by descriptive statistical techniques such as frequencies/percentages and means. Analysis indicates that majority of males and females were well aware of terms ICT and Internet. Based on data, it was observed that males use Internet more, stay for longer duration on Internet and visit sites more number of times. As for the type of service utilize, majority of the respondents used Internet for social communication and educational material followed by recreational purpose. Males considered Internet more beneficial than females. Data also revealed that males used Internet more for e-shopping. Findings of the study were discussed in the light of earlier researches and suggestions for further probe were also stated.
